CILICIA. Colybrassus. Marcus Aurelius, 161-180. Assarion (Bronze, 19 mm, 5.29 g, 12 h). ΑYΤ ΚΑΙΟ (sic!) ΑΝΤΩΝЄΙΝΟС Laureate, draped and cuirassed bust of Marcus Aurelius to right, seen from behind. Rev. ΚΟΛYΒΡΑССЄωΝ Athena standing front, head to left, holding patera in her right hand and spear in her left. RPC IV online 3572. SNG Levante 315. Rare, just three examples listed in RPC. A lovely coin with an attractive green patina. Good very fine.

From the collection of Dr. P. Vogl, ex Aufhäuser 7, 9 October 1990, 478 (with collector's ticket).
